		<description>The problem is that the pages have no true use.  They only get traffic due to curiosity, after that point they have no value just being a page of ads.  Why would someone ever come back?  And now that the idea has already been done with the original Million Dollar Homepage, the idea isn't that interesting or unique anymore.  Putting a tiny Web 2.0 twist on it doesn't make it more interesting.

In fact, the Web 2.0ish type of user probably is less curious or interested than the average web user who might think it's neat.

Good luck with it, but I just don't think it has much value.</description>
